### Action Item: Spoolhaven Retry Storm

From last Tuesday's outage: the Spoolhaven print service retried failed jobs without backoff, saturating the render pool. Fix merged; retries now use capped exponential backoff with jitter. Owner will monitor for a week before closing. The agreed retry constants are recorded below.

constants for yadup-kajof:
RATE_LIMITS = {
    "zorwyn": 1,
    "druwyn": 1,
}

14:22 — Ops confirmed that autocomplete latency on Pellwick Search had climbed past 900ms p95. The suffix index had not been compacted since the Tuesday deploy, so lookups were scanning stale segments. Marta triggered a manual compaction and latency recovered within eight minutes. No customer-facing errors, but the degradation lasted roughly 40 minutes. For the release manager: the deploy that introduced the compaction regression is traceable via the token below.

pipeline stamp: htk9_ce63042d9

Ticket: SQL lint config drift across repos

The Ledgerpine repos have drifted from the shared SQL linting rules—three projects still allow unqualified column names and mixed-case keywords. New team members keep inheriting the stale configs. We should resync everything to the central ruleset this sprint. The canonical linter configuration we are standardizing on is below.

settings of fafog-haduf:
ZORIX_PIN=4648
ZORIX_METRICS_HOST=metrics.zorix.paliqsys.corp
ZORIX_LOG_LEVEL=info
ZORIX_TENANT=druix

**Q3 Planning Note — Incoming Director**

Ventrix delivered their term sheet last week. Key points: 18-month exclusivity in the Corland market, milestone-based payments, co-branding on the Lattice platform. Legal flagged the indemnity clause; revision requested. Counter due Friday. No board vote needed until terms finalize. Read the appended note before the Ventrix call.

management briefing: Project Ulavan slips by two quarters because of the staffing delay.